Summary

Dollar Tree, Inc. (DLTR) announced a board-level appointment in an 8-K filing dated September 20, 2023. Effective September 19, 2023, Ms. Randolph was appointed as a member of both the Audit and Finance Committees of the Board of Directors. This appointment is significant as it brings new expertise to critical oversight functions of the company. The Audit Committee is responsible for overseeing the integrity of the company's financial reporting, internal controls, and audit processes, while the Finance Committee plays a key role in financial strategy and capital allocation.
